From School to Battlefield to Grave How Russian Cossacks drive young people to war This video was posted in April 2024 by Беркут , a student association within a Russian Federal University. Students, about to leave for an Airsoft competition , stand in military formation outside a campus building .

This is Олег Монин who took Berkut’s oath four months earlier . Through this veiled Cossack Youth Organisation, he trained in combat tactics with returned fighters and transitioned from pretend to real weapons. Within a year, Oleg abandoned his studies and enlisted in БАРС-15 , a Cossack Volunteer Battalion fighting in Ukraine.

By Feb. 10, 2025 Oleg was dead. He died aged 19, less than four months after deployment in Ukraine.
